Iga Deficiency: Signs, Causes, And How To Treat

IgA deficiency is a rare immune disorder where the body lacks enough IgA antibodies to fight infections. This can make individuals more susceptible to illnesses. The causes of IgA deficiency are not well understood but are believed to involve genetic factors. Understanding this condition can help individuals better manage their health and work with healthcare providers to prevent infections.

Symptoms of Iga Deficiency

Patients may experience chronic cough, nasal congestion, and recurrent sore throats.  Skin conditions like eczema and allergies can also occur.  Additionally, they may have autoimmune diseases or be more prone to certain infections due to the lack of IgA antibodies in their system.

  • Frequent infections: People with IgA deficiency may experience recurrent respiratory infections, sinus infections, or gastrointestinal infections due to a weakened immune response.
  • Digestive issues: Some individuals with IgA deficiency may have symptoms like chronic diarrhea, abdominal pain, and bloating, which can be related to gastrointestinal problems.
  • Skin problems: Skin conditions such as eczema or dermatitis may occur in individuals with IgA deficiency, leading to persistent rashes or itchy skin.
  • Allergies: IgA deficiency may contribute to an increased risk of developing allergies, causing symptoms like nasal congestion, sneezing, or itchy eyes when exposed to allergens.

Causes of Iga Deficiency

Additionally, environmental factors and family history may also contribute to the development of IgA deficiency.  Early detection and proper management are essential in individuals with this condition to prevent complications and improve quality of life.

  • Genetic factors such as inherited mutations in the genes responsible for producing IgA antibodies can lead to IgA deficiency.
  • Certain autoimmune conditions, such as rheumatoid arthritis or systemic lupus erythematosus, may be associated with IgA deficiency.

Risk Factors

The risk factors for IgA deficiency include genetics, as it tends to run in families, with a higher likelihood of occurrence in people with a family history of the condition. Certain autoimmune disorders, such as rheumatoid arthritis and lupus, can also increase the risk. 

  • Family history of IgA deficiency increases the risk of developing the condition, as genetics play a significant role in its occurrence.
  • Certain autoimmune diseases, such as rheumatoid arthritis and systemic lupus erythematosus, are associated with a higher likelihood of IgA deficiency.

Diagnosis of Iga Deficiency

Your doctor may also perform additional tests to rule out other conditions.  If your IgA levels are low, it may indicate IgA deficiency.  Early detection is important for proper management.  Talk to your doctor if you have symptoms like frequent infections or gastrointestinal issues.

  • Blood Tests: A simple blood test can measure the levels of immunoglobulin A (IgA) in the blood, helping to diagnose IgA deficiency.
  • Immunoelectrophoresis: This specialized laboratory technique can separate and identify different types of immunoglobulins, including IgA, to confirm the deficiency.
  • Genetic Testing: Genetic testing can be performed to identify specific gene mutations that are associated with IgA deficiency.
  • Clinical Symptoms: Symptoms such as recurrent infections, particularly respiratory and gastrointestinal infections, can provide important clues for diagnosing IgA deficiency.

Treatment for Iga Deficiency

Treatment for IgA deficiency focuses on managing symptoms and preventing infections. This may include antibiotics for recurrent infections, immunoglobulin replacement therapy to boost immunity, and regular monitoring by a healthcare provider. Lifestyle adjustments like maintaining good hygiene and a healthy diet can also help manage symptoms.

  • Immunoglobulin replacement therapy is a common treatment option for IgA deficiency, where intravenous immunoglobulin (IVIG) or subcutaneous immunoglobulin (SCIG) is administered to help boost the immune system.
  • Antibiotics may be prescribed to manage recurrent infections in individuals with IgA deficiency, as they can help prevent and treat bacterial infections that may arise due to the weakened immune response.
